JSON: JavaScript Object Notation(JavaScript 对象标记法)。
JSON 是一种存储和交换数据的语法。
JSON 是通过 JavaScript 对象标记法书写的文本。

为什么使用 JSON?
因为 JSON 格式仅仅是文本,它能够轻松地在服务器浏览器之间传输,并用作任何编程语言的数据格式。

JSON应用

交换数据
发送数据
接收数据
存储数据

JSON实例

  1. {
  2. "sites": [
  3. { "name":"菜鸟教程" , "url":"www.runoob.com" },
  4. { "name":"google" , "url":"www.google.com" },
  5. { "name":"微博" , "url":"www.weibo.com" }
  6. ]
  7. }

JSON 语法

数据在名称/值对中
数据由逗号分隔
大括号 {} 保存对象
中括号 [] 保存数组,数组可以包含多个对象

JSON 值

JSON 值可以是:
数字(整数或浮点数)
字符串(在双引号中)
逻辑值(true 或 false)
数组(在中括号中)
对象(在大括号中)
null

END